Participated and Nonparticipated in Terms of Their Interpersonal Relationship and Life Satisfaction
Abstract
This study was a comparison study of older adults who did and did not participate in learning in terms of their interpersonal relationship and life satisfaction. The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ship between learning and interpersonal relationship as well as learning and life satisfaction among older adults. Based on the results of this study, recommendations were provided to related organizations in planning older adult education.
This study was done with questionnaires by surveying older adults in Jia-yi city and Jia-yi county. 450 questionnaires were sent out, and 435 were returned with a return rate of 96.67%. The total number of valid questionnaire was 430.
The conclusions of this study were:
1.The interpersonal relationship of older adults who participated in learning was better than those who didn’t.
2.The life satisfaction of older adults who participated in learning was higher than those who didn’t.
3.The need of participating in learning was confirmed and received by older adults.
4.The reason that most older adults thought why they needed to learn was “to make friends”; the reason that most older adults think why they didn’t need to learn was “learning is useless when you are old.”
5.The reason why older adults did not participate in learning was primarily due to “do not have time.”
6.The most popular organizations where older adults took part in learning were “evergreen associations of villages and towns.”
7.“Education background” and “health condition” were the factors which influenced the learning participation of older adults.
8.“Health condition” was a factor that affected older adults interpersonal relationship.
9.Life satisfaction of older adult was related to the demographic characteristics of older adults.
According to the results of this study, recommendations were made regarding (1) governmental organizations,(2) related institutions of older adults, and(3) older adults.
